Transaction 85265eedf23fa9dd656832f9d5fb20716953c67091bcb83b077217b646d8ef28
1 Input
1 Output
-
85265eedf23fa9dd656832f9d5fb20716953c67091bcb83b077217b646d8ef28:0
- value
- 14552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 908af66bcda59967c692f938ee01a34bcaffc4ab OP_EQUAL
- address
- 3EsHhTT2vqqQdXucDkfpKNz5ercwobgkFG